Introduction to Serkyem
The Serkyem, also known as Golden Drink, is part of the Dharma Protector's practice. In Tibetan, Ser means "golden," and Kyem means "beverage."
It is offered by pouring the beverage into a cup-like wine glass and placing it into a lower bowl. The beverage is poured into the cup during the offering, where the liquid overflows into the lower bowl. The symbol of the overflowing liquid is highly auspicious because it represents an abundant flow of merits.
